Travel - Parliament Hill in Ottawa 61 images Created 22 Dec 2010
Images from a winter visit to Ottawa, Ontario which is the Capital city of Canada. The Christmas Lights shining on Parliament Hill were stunning and the lights of the city made the clouds above glow like day even though these images were made late at night.